The computation of the bad debt expense is shown below:
= Credit sales × estimated percentage given
= $500,000 × 1%
= $5,000
The journal entries are also shown below; for better understanding
Bad debt expense A/c Dr $5,000
To Allowance for doubtful debts $5,000
(Being bad debt expense is recorded)
